Picloxydine is a heterocyclic biguanide with antibacterial and antiplaque activity. In Vivo 0.4% Picloxydine produces a highly significant drop in the number of aerobic organisms. 0.4% Picloxydine is far more effective than 0.2% Picloxydine or chlorhexidine in reducing the total viable count of oral aerobic and anaerobic organisms . Picloxydine is also used in eye drops in the topical therapy of trachoma. MCE has not independently confirmed the accuracy of these methods. They are for reference only.
